REPORT PROVES THERE IS A CRISIS IN NHS DENTISTRY - MULHOLLAND

12.00.00am BST (GMT +0100) Mon 15th Oct 2007

Commenting following a Dentistry Watch survey of dental patients undertaken by the Commission for Patient and Public Involvement in Health, which revealed that large numbers of people are still experiencing significant problems getting access to NHS dental care, Leeds MP Greg Mulholland said:

"Unfortunately this survey is simply proof of what we already knew - NHS dentistry is in crisis.

"The numbers of people are still unable to get access to NHS dental care prove that the new dental contract has been an utter failure.

"The Government is in denial about the crisis in the system. Ministers must admit the failings of the contract and admit the case for a thorough and urgent review of NHS dentistry.

" If the Government continue with this complacent attitude, there is a serious danger that NHS dentistry will become a thing of the past."
